Cook ravioli according to package directions on the stovetop in water.
Preheat air fryer to 400 degrees and spray your air fryer basket with non stick spray.
On a plate combine breadcrumbs and parmesan cheese.
Whisk egg in a bowl and dredge each cooked and slightly cooled ravioli one at a time, followed by pressing each side into your breadcrumb mixture so each one is coated. Shake excess crumbs off and place each one inside air fryer basket. Do not overlap them.
Cook at 400 degrees for 3-4 minutes or until crispy on the outside. Can flip them halfway through but not totally necessary.
